17 * a utility to accumulate a zero-terminated array of void* values
19 * (Ah, lovely C, makes it such a delight to accumulate a collection
20 * whose length isn't known in advance.. but it's probably more fun
21 * than trying to teach the SBCL debugger to walk g++ stack frames, not to
22 * mention dealing with g++'s lovely in-which-file-do-templates-expand
23 * issues; or than trying to use Lisp for all accumulation and having to
24 * hassle about FFIing all the details of opendir/readdir/closedir
25 * and so forth.)
27 * We more or less simulate C++-style ctors and dtors.
29 typedef struct
30 voidacc { /* the accumulator itself, to be treated as an opaque data type */
31 /*private:*/
32 void **result;
33 int n_avail;
34 int n_used;
35 } voidacc;
36 int voidacc_ctor(voidacc*); /* the ctor, returning 0 for success */
37 int voidacc_acc(voidacc*, void*); /* Accumulate an element into result,
38 * returning 0 for success. */
39 void** voidacc_give_away_result(voidacc*); /* giving away ownership */
40 void voidacc_dtor(voidacc*); /* the dtor */
